How Our Wood Trim Water Damage Restoration Process Works
Our process begins with a thorough assessment of the affected area, where our technicians identify the source of the damage and develop a customized plan to restore your wood trim. We use advanced equipment, such as thermal imaging cameras and moisture meters, to detect hidden water damage and ensure a thorough drying process.
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team assesses the damage and creates a customized plan to restore your wood trim. We identify the source of the damage and develop a strategy to prevent further damage.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We use specialized equipment to extract water from the affected area, including wet/dry vacuums and pumps.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We use advanced equipment, such as dehumidifiers and fans, to dry the affected area and prevent further damage.
Step 4: Cleaning and Disinfecting
We use eco-friendly and non-toxic cleaning products to clean and disinfect the affected area, ensuring a safe and healthy environment for your family.
Step 5: Restoration and Repair
Our team repairs and restores your wood trim to its original condition, using high-quality materials and craftsmanship.

Warning Signs You Need Wood Trim Water Damage Restoration
Catching water damage early on can save you money and prevent bigger problems down the line. Look out for these warning signs: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, unpleasant odors in your home can be a sign of hidden water damage. If you notice musty smells, it’s essential to investigate further and address the issue quickly.
Warped or Discolored Wood Trim
Warped or discolored wood trim can be a sign of water damage. If you notice any changes in the appearance of your wood trim, it’s crucial to inspect the area further and address the issue.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of water damage. If you notice any peeling or bubbling, it’s essential to investigate further and address the issue quickly.
Water Stains on Ceilings or Walls
Water stains on ceilings or walls can be a sign of hidden water damage. If you notice any water stains, it’s crucial to investigate further and address the issue.
Visible Water Damage or Leaks
Visible water damage or leaks can be a sign of a larger issue. If you notice any water damage or leaks,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.
Unusual Sounds or Creaks
Unusual sounds or creaks in your home can be a sign of hidden water damage. If you notice any unusual sounds or creaks, it’s crucial to investigate further and address the issue.

Wood Trim Water Damage Restoration Cost in Ipswich, MA
The cost of wood trim water damage restoration can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Ipswich, MA. On average, you can expect to pay between $500 and $2,500 for a typical water damage restoration project.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ment used |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$3,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ment used |
| Cleaning and Disinfecting | $500 – $1,500 | Size of affected area, type of cleaning products used |
| Restoration and Repair | $2,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of materials used |
| Moisture Detection | $200 – $500 | Size of affected area, type of equipment used |
| Inspection and Assessment | $100 – $300 | Size of affected area, complexity of damage |
The cost of wood trim water damage restoration can vary depending on the specific services required and the severity of the damage. Common Questions About Wood Trim Water Damage Restoration
Q: What causes water damage to wood trim?
A: Water damage to wood trim can be caused by a variety of factors, including leaks, burst pipes, and flooding. It’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age and ensure a safe and healthy environment.
Q: How long does wood trim water damage restoration take?
A: The length of time required for wood trim water damage restoration can vary depending on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. On average, you can expect the process to take anywhere from a few days to a week or more.
Q: Is wood trim water damage restoration covered by insurance?
A: In many cases, wood trim water damage restoration is covered by insurance. But, it’s essential to check with your insurance provider to confirm coverage and to ensure that you follow the necessary procedures to file a claim.
Q: Can I prevent water damage to my wood trim?
A: Yes, you can take steps to prevent water damage to your wood trim. Regularly inspect your home for signs of water damage, and address any issues quickly. You can also consider installing a water detection system to alert you to potential problems.
